摘要: 采用自制有机改性膨润土对水中苯酚进行吸附研究, 探讨了吸附时间、 吸附溶液的pH值、 吸附溶液浓度等因素对吸附效果的影响. 结果表明, 改性后的有机膨润土能有效吸附水中的苯酚, 有机改性膨润土改善了其微观结构, 提高了膨润土的吸附能力和离子交换能力.

关键词: 膨润土, 苯酚, 吸附性能

Abstract: The adsorption of phenol by organobentonite was researched. The effects of adsorption time, pH value and anionpositive ion on adsorption efficiency were examined. The test results indicated that organobentonite co uld effectively adsorb phenol. After modification treatment, the property of orga nobentonite was improved, and the capacities of adsorption and ionexchange were increased. The method of regeneration of organobentonite was good.

Key words: organobentonite, phenol, adsorption characteristics
